Which font is best for letters?

The Best Font to Choose Using a simple font will ensure that your message is clear. Basic fonts like Arial, Cambria, Calibri, Verdana, Courier New, and Times New Roman work well. Avoid novelty fonts like Comic Sans, or fonts in script or handwriting-style.

What are fonts and typefaces?

In typography, a typeface (also known as font family) is a set of one or more fonts each composed of glyphs that share common design features. Each font of a typeface has a specific weight, style, condensation, width, slant, italicization, ornamentation, and designer or foundry (and formerly size, in metal fonts).

What is the name of cursive font?

Scrawl Cursive designed by Tanya David is a typical font family of cursive style. A unique feature of this font is that many capital letters will join when preceding lower case letters, which will create much more real flow.
